What is the Kansas Driver's License Renewal Form?
The Kansas Driver's License Renewal Form serves as a crucial document for military personnel and their dependents who reside out of state or country, enabling them to renew, replace, or extend their driver's license. It provides an essential pathway for maintaining legal driving status while away from their home state.
For military individuals and their families, the form not only facilitates the renewal process but also ensures that they can carry out these tasks without returning to Kansas in person. It's important to remember that signing the form is a necessary step before submission.
Who Needs the Kansas Driver's License Renewal Form?
This form is primarily targeted at military service members and their dependents, especially those under the age of 21. To be eligible, applicants must meet specific criteria, including proof of service and residency.
-
Military service members and their dependents under 21
-
Individuals living outside Kansas or the U.S.
Civilians or those over the age of 21 should refrain from using this form, as it is designated specifically for military-related circumstances.

Who is eligible to use the Kansas Driver's License Renewal Form?
The form is specifically for military personnel and their dependents under 21 who are residing out of state or outside the country and need to renew, replace, or extend their Kansas driver's license.
